The last couple of updates on my Ubuntu 12.04 system have failed. I get 
a pop up window titled "update-manager" that says:

--------------------------------------------------
Package operation failed

The installation or removal of a software package failed.

Details
--------------------------------------------------

Expanding the Details I see a very long list of stuff in the window.

It starts with:

--------------------------------------------------
installArchives() failed:
(Reading database ...
(Reading database ... 5%%
(Reading database ... 10%%
(Reading database ... 15%%

...

(Reading database ... 95%%
(Reading database ... 100%%
(Reading database ... 307367 files and directories currently installed.)
Preparing to replace linux-libc-dev 3.2.0-91.129 (using 
.../linux-libc-dev_3.2.0-92.130_amd64.deb) ...
Unpacking replacement linux-libc-dev ...
Setting up samba4 (4.0.0~alpha18.dfsg1-4ubuntu2) ...
Unknown parameter encountered: "Max Protocol"

...
--------------------------------------------------

There are a number of "Unknown parameter encountered:" (name of 
parameter) entries followed by "Ignoring unknown parameter" (name of 
parameter).

--------------------------------------------------
...

Unknown parameter encountered: "guest ok"
Ignoring unknown parameter "guest ok"
ERROR: Invalid smb.conf
/var/lib/dpkg/info/samba4.postinst: 14: 
/var/lib/dpkg/info/samba4.postinst: /usr/share/samba/setoption.pl: 
Permission denied
dpkg: error processing samba4 (--configure):
  subprocess installed post-installation script returned error exit 
status 126

--------------------------------------------------

I can see that it's likely something wrong in smb.conf, and I'll have to 
run testparm and try to figure out what's going on. But, I'd like to be 
able to read this detail of the error outside of the error message box 
after I've closed it. Which log should I be looking for?
